UFO Video Submissions
** HOME PAGE **
** WEBCAST **
** TWITTER **
Thursday, 5 April 2012
UFO or BALL LIGHTNING - New Orleans - April 02, 2012 (Video)
Uploaded by
crazybreakingnews
on
3 Apr 2012
"An incredible UFO sighting or a rare weather phenomenon called Ball Lightning with a thunderstorm near New Orleans on April 02nd, 2012."
Newer Post
Older Post
Home